Politics / Check Out INEC List Of Governorship Candidates In Enugu by Wiki9ja: 2:32pm On Nov 10, 2018
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) on Friday released names of governorship candidates in Enugu State.

On the list were the top contender, Governor Ifeanyi Ugwuanyi of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Senator Ayogu Eze of All Progressives Congress (APC).

It also contained 37 others party candidates.

The list was displayed at the INEC Headquarters in Enugu on Friday in line with the guidelines for the 2019 general elections.

Others whose names appeared on the list include Ekene Uzodimma of United Progressives Party (UPP), Peter Aniagbaso of Social Democratic Party (SDP), Cajethan Eze of Action Democratic Party (ADC) and Emmanuel Nwankpa of All Progressives Grand Alliance (APGA).

The names of candidates for the State House of Assembly elections were also displayed alongside the governorship candidates.

According to the timetable for the polls, political parties were expected to commence their campaigns on November 18.

Dr Emeka Ononamadu, the Resident Electoral Commissioner in Enugu State while briefing journalists earlier in the week, said the commission has so far not been found wanting in keeping to the guidelines and timetable for the polls.

Ononamadu assured that with the support of the people, INEC would deliver free, fair and credible elections next year in Enugu State.

Politics / WAEC Certificate: Keyamo Reveals Opposition’s Plan Against Buhari by Wiki9ja: 7:38am On Nov 05, 2018
The Director of Strategic Communications of Buhari Campaign Organisation, Festus Keyamo on Sunday said the opposition was trying to nail President Muhammadu Buhari.



He stated that plans were in motion outside the country to scrutinize the president’s West African Examinations Council (WAEC) certificate.

Buhari on Friday, in Abuja received the attestation and confirmation of his 1961 West African School Certificate (WASC) Examination.

The documents were presented to him at State House during a courtesy visit by a delegation of WAEC led by its Registrar, Dr Iyi Uwadiae, accompanied by Olutise Adenipekun, Head, National Office, Abiodun Aduloju, Head Public Affairs, and Olufemi Oke, Zonal Coordinator, Abuja.

On Twitter, Keyamo lambasted those insisting that the certificate was forged, adding that Buhari’s opponents were holding meetings on next action.

“The dumbest comments I’ve read about d now dead issue of PMB’s WAEC result is to say WAEC forged its own document”, he wrote.

“Where there’s ONLY ONE body authorized by law to issue a document, it can only make mistakes or clerical errors on it (I don’t concede that here) but cannot forge it.

“On a lighter note, we understand the opposition is now hunting for the examiners who marked PMB’s scripts in 1961 to ascertain whether the grades in PMB’s WAEC result tallies with the marks they actually gave him.

“They’re flying in some US investigators to Dubai for consultation,” he stated.

Politics / Ganduje: Pressure Mounts On Buhari by Wiki9ja: 12:25pm On Nov 04, 2018
Socio-Economic Rights and Accountability Project (SERAP), has sent an open letter to President Muhammadu Buhari, urging him to direct the Attorney General of the Federation and Minister of Justice, Abubakar Malami, SAN, to order anti-corruption agencies to investigate allegations of bribery against Governor Abdullahi Ganduje of Kano State.



Ganduje had on Friday denied collecting any form of bribe from contractors.

But, the organization said if there were relevant and sufficient admissible evidences, Ganduje should face prosecution at the expiration of his tenure as governor.

The letter signed by SERAP Senior Legal Adviser, Ms Bamisope Adeyanju, noted: “Given the history of corruption in Nigeria, especially unresolved allegations of grand corruption against many state governors, your government cannot and should not look the other way regarding the allegations against Mr. Ganduje. Any allegations of bribery and abuse of power in any state of Nigeria is of concern to every Nigerian, and should therefore, be of concern to your government.

“The obligations of your government to combat corruption in Nigeria extend to all the three tiers of government, namely, the federal government, state government and local government. Although primarily a matter of concern for Kano State, the allegations of bribery against Mr Ganduje have assumed such a proportion as to become a matter of concern to the federation as a whole, and therefore, to your government.

“Taking the recommended steps would help to enhance your government’s fight against corruption and contribute hugely to promoting the public interest, the interest of justice as well as prevent any abuse of the legal process. Any failure and/or refusal to act would undermine the goal of your government’s anti-corruption fight and tacitly serve to encourage persistent allegations of corruption among many state governors to continue with almost absolute impunity.

“SERAP is concerned that growing allegations of corruption including bribery against many state governors have not been investigated and that several of the governors involved are getting away with their alleged crimes.

“We note that while a governor may enjoy immunity from arrest and prosecution, he does not enjoy immunity from investigation. Any criminal allegation against a sitting governor including Mr. Ganduje can and should be investigated pending the time the governor leaves office and loses immunity. The findings of such investigation can also be the basis for initiating impeachment proceedings against the governor.”

Politics / Parents Of Dapchi Schoolgirls Raise Alarm Over Govt Negligence Of Girls by Wiki9ja: 12:04pm On Oct 30, 2018
Some parents of returned Dapchi school girls, earlier abducted by Boko Haram terrorists, have accused the leadership of their parents’ association of turning their daughters’ misfortune into a profit-making venture.

The parents made this accusation in a telephone interview with WIKI 9JA correspondent, where they also alleged that the leadership of the association are being selective in the distribution of relief materials whenever such come their way.

Usman Saleh Gashua, who is the father of Maryam Usman, one of the returned girls, said, “We heard that recently, the Presidential Committee for the Northeast Initiative (PCNI) has given the parents’ association food and non-food items for onward distribution to us but I didn’t receive anything till the present day.

“When I contacted the chairman of the association about our own share. He said the materials were meant for the parents of the girls residing in Dapchi town only”.

The father of the 22-years-old JSS 1 student disclosed that he deliberately refused to re-enroll his daughter to the school after their return because of the fear of some unscrupolous individuals who are opportunistic to use his daughter in order to enrich themselves.

“I was approached to return my daughter back to the school, but I refused. Because some are using them for their personal gains,” he claimed.

“Even when Yobe-Turkish College had announced that all the girls should come for scholarship examination, but nobody called me inform me about the development, only to learn that the exam was conducted,” he added.

Another parent, Nasiru Ibrahim from Girim village and father of Rabi Nasiru also made similar allegation, stating that he has benefited once from the PCNI’s gesture where he was given some relief materials.

“I was given three measures of rice, two measures of millet, five bottles of cooking oil and a small bag of corn flour. That is what came to me and I have to accept it.”

He described those who are using the parents’ association to make money as mindless persons whose actions are for selfish interest.

“When our daughters were returned, I expect the federal government to take charge of their welfare for a time being, because as I can tell you my daughter’s behaviour has charged. She needs psychosocial support,” he pointed out.

Ibrahim further said he was compelled to return Rabi to GGSTC Dapchi because her manners have change so that she might get support there.

Responding to the allegations, chairman of the association of parents of Dapchi schoolgirls, Bashir Manzo denied any knowledge of misconduct by members of the association.

“I will be interested if an investigation will unmask those behind the said wrongdoings by the some parents of the girls”.

On Yobe-Turkish college scholarship, Manzo said it was the management of the college that conducted the examination.

“It was the official from the Turkish college that came to GGSTC Dapchi that conducted the exam where selected only 20 successfull, excluding my own daughter,” he said.

He challenged the aggrieved members of the association to prove their claims.

Politics / Don’t Expect Change In Rivers State Unless APC Wins – Amaechi by Wiki9ja: 6:55pm On Oct 27, 2018
The Minster for Transportation, Chibuike Amaechi, has told his supporters and members of the All Progressives Congress, APC, in Rivers State not to expect any change in the state unless his party is returned to power in 2019.

Amaechi, a former Governor of Rivers State, said his supporters will not make benefits from the party unless the APC came out victorious in the 2019 general elections.

He urged them to mobilise and register more voters for the APC to ensure victory for the party in the 2019 general elections.

Amaechi, the Minister of Transportation, said this on Saturday, during a ward-to-ward sensitisation visit tagged ‘Operation show your PVC’, to communities in Ikwerre Local Government Area of the state.

The Minister said the only way to benefit from government was to elect good leaders.

He Said, “You people need to work hard because, if we don’t win you, will not get any benefit. The day we win, is the day we should expect change in Rivers State.

“When we win, we will focus more on bettering the lots of our people because I believe that things should change.

“The only way to effect that change is to go to your various units and wards and commence new registration of members and I expect the new members to have their voters’ cards; that is the tool you will use to remove bad leaders,” he said.
